Wednesday, September 22, 2010. What a day. Preschool? Check At least Zachary isn't quite as grumpy today because he got to bring Mr. Bear home. Mr. Bear is the class "pet" that each child gets to bring home the night before their "special helper day". They are supposed to take him on an adventure of sorts, write about it in the Mr. Bear book and bring him back to school the next day. Me: Zachary, are you excited that Mr. Bear is coming home with us? Me: What are we going to do with him? Off to make dinner.

Monday, January 24, 2011. Zachary decided to skip lunch today, or so I thought. I offered him ravioli and he declined. Apparently he wasn't hungry after the three yogurts and four pounds of fruit he consumed for breakfast. I didn't really think twice about it. About an hour later I saw him walking around with a sandwich. I wasn't sure where it came from, but it looked less than appetizing. Me: What are you eating? Me: Where did you get it? Zachary: I made it. Sandwich. And he ate the entire thing! Me: Be...

Friday, August 10, 2012. Aubree lost her first tooth while we were camping last weekend. Lucky for her, the tooth fairy was able to find us at the campground, and leave her some money in exchange for her tooth. She didn't really seem too excited about the tooth fairy coming, but apparently it has been on her mind. Aubree: "I lost my nail, so I took it and put it under my pillow last night. But the nail fairy didn't find it. There was no money. Isn't there a nail fairy? Subscribe to: Post Comments (Atom).
